The essentials
This VIZ-PRO cork bulletin board comes with an overall size of 120 x 90 cm, including the frame, and an available surface size of 116 cm x 86 cm for pinning. It includes fixing kits, so you’re not starting from zero when it’s time to mount it.
A key part of the appeal is the natural cork surface designed to accept pins. It’s described as self-healing, and the cork is positioned as high-density—helping your pins hold more securely in place. In day-to-day terms, that means fewer weak pin holds when you’re swapping up a timetable or adding the occasional photo.

What stands out in use
You can expect the board to feel more “practical” than purely decorative. Cork is forgiving for everyday updates: push a pin in to attach a note, replace it later, and the surface is intended to recover its look over time.
The black aluminium frame and ABS plastic corner pieces add structure, and the upgraded frame includes covers intended to hide mounting screws. That’s a detail you only really appreciate once it’s on the wall—when you don’t have visible fixings breaking up the look.
There’s also flexibility in installation. The mounting is described as allowing you to set the board up either horizontally or vertically, so you can orient it to suit the space you’ve got rather than forcing the room to match the board.


Key features that matter (and a couple of limits)

The cork is the headline: natural cork with a self-healing design for pin-based display. The board is also described as using a high-density cork meant to hold pins firmly.
The frame approach is practical, not just aesthetic. Anti-scratch, black-finished aluminium is paired with screw-fixing through the corners and corner plastic (ABS) pieces. On top of that, the design includes covers to keep mounting screws hidden.
One limitation to keep in mind: self-healing and pin retention are only part of the story. If you’re regularly using heavy items or forcing pins in at odd angles, you may still see wear around pin holes over time—so it’s more “built for everyday pinning” than “designed for permanent museum displays”.

When you might want to skip it


It may not be a great match if you don’t plan to use pins much, or if you prefer a board that’s meant for writing or marker-based updates rather than pinning.
Also, if your wall space is tight, double-check the overall size (120 x 90 cm) versus the usable surface area (116 cm x 86 cm). The difference is small, but it matters when you’re measuring up for a precise fit.

Finally, if you expect the cork surface to stay flawless indefinitely even with frequent pin removal and constant re-pin placement, you may find it slightly more “real-world” than “perfect”. It’s designed for everyday use, not for static, unchanging displays.
